About

Andreas Schwenke is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ials and Computational Mechanics. According to data from OpenAlex, Andreas Schwenke has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 506 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 5 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 3 papers in Computational Mechanics. Recurrent topics in Andreas Schwenke’s work include Laser-Ablation Synthesis of Nanoparticles (12 papers), Nonlinear Optical Materials Studies (9 papers) and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(4 papers). Andreas Schwenke is often cited by papers focused on Laser-Ablation Synthesis of Nanoparticles (12 papers), Nonlinear Optical Materials Studies (9 papers) and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(4 papers). Andreas Schwenke coll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Türkiye and Iran. Andreas Schwenke's co-authors include Philipp Wagener, Stephan Barcikowski, Boris N. Chichkov, Stefan Nolte, Gudrun Brandes, Bernd Eberle, Christian Kübel, Gunnar Ritt, Ana Menéndez-Manjón and Ulrich Giese and has published in prestigious journals such as Langmuir, The Journal of Physical Chemistry C and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ics.
